Jaeger-LeCoultre Unique Heritage on Display
Feb 01, 2008 The Swiss-based Jaeger-LeCoultre Company was established in 1833 in the Vallee de Joux's Le Sentier. It represents one of the few watch companies that has been located at one and the same site during the entire period of its existence.

Panerai Luminor 1950 Tourbillon GMT
Nov 29, 2007 Among the four recently developed mechanisms, from the point of view of construction, the Panerai P. 2005 represents the most sophisticated caliber. On the base of this caliber, the manufacture has created the Luminor 1950 Tourbillon GMT, the timepiece that has successfully united tradition, sports characteristics, precision and technology.
